WebFigures created through the pyplot interface (`matplotlib.pyplot.figure`) are retained until explicitly closed and may consume too much memory. (To control this warning, see the rcParam `figure.max_open_warning`). max_open_warning, RuntimeWarning) 0 An error occurred while loading designs. Please try again. Tasks 0 WebAug 13, 2024 · Gcf.get_fig_manager(num)ifmanagerisNone:max_open_warning=rcParams['figure.max_open_warning']iflen(allnums)==max_open_warning>=1:_api.warn_external(f"More than {max_open_warning}figures have been opened. "f"Figures created through the pyplot interface "f"(`matplotlib.pyplot.figure`) are retained until explicitly "f"closed and may …
[Matplotlib-users] Closing figures in nbagg mode - Python
WebRuntimeWarning: More than 20 figures have been opened. Figures created through the … WebAug 3, 2024 · . 如果你创建了太多的 figure 对象,你会收到这个警告。 使用以下代码,能清除并且关闭掉 figure 对象。 plt.cla () plt.close ( "all") . 但是请注意,如果你需要画很多图,这样频繁的 “创建→清除” 是会拖慢你的代码运行速度的。 最好的办法是,只创建一个 figure 对象,在画下一个图之前,使用 plt.clf () 清理掉 axes,这样可以复用 figure。 参考: … importing cats to hawaii
matplotlib get rid of max_open_warning output - Stack …
WebJan 30, 2024 · Figures created through the pyplot interface (`matplotlib.pyplot.figure`) are retained until explicitly closed and may consume too much memory. (To control this warning, see the rcParam `figure.max_open_warning`). max_open_warning, RuntimeWarning) 問題のコードは次のとおり WebRuntimeWarning: More than 20 figures have been opened. Figures created through the pyplot interface (`matplotlib. pyplot. figure`) are retained until explicitly closed and may consume too much memory. (To control this warning, see the rcParam `figure. max_open_warning`). fig, ax = plt. subplots (figsize = (10, 10))原因分析: 出现这种问题就 … WebMar 18, 2024 · $ python plot. py plot. py: 22: RuntimeWarning: More than 20 figures have … importing cats into canada